Berkeley Bumpers: Self Loathing Motorists?

Over the past couple days I've seen variations of this image on two Hondas: an evolutionary progression of ape into man riding a bicycle. I'm hard pressed to argue the merits of what I take to be the underlying message, that in our contemporary society man has evolved the potential to be contemplative of his impact on the world, and so rides a bike. I do find it curious that this message should appear on the rears of cars, and one of them an SUV no less. Is this a self-flagellating gesture? An eco-conscious hankie code alerting those in the know that these motorists are at heart bicyclists, constrained by circumstance to ruin the environment against their will at a faster rate than they would otherwise desire? Is this the new way of saying "My other car is a bike"?

The owners of the vehicles weren't around for me to ask about their bumper stickers so we'll just have to speculate on who or what is making these poor people drive their cars instead of their bikes.
